HILTON HEAD, S.C. – The Washington & Jefferson College men's tennis team dropped a 7-0 decision to Gordon.
After a convincing victory of Salve Regina a day ago, the Presidents now drop to 2-6 in nonconference action.
W&J opened the day with a winless effort in the doubles matches, granting Gordon the first team point of the match. Both No. 1 and 2 doubles dropped 6-1 matches while No. 2 doubles lost 6-2.
Nate Clarke (New Kensington, Pa./Valley) and
Alex Duing (South Park, Pa./South Park) put up a valiant effort at No. 2 doubles.
Down 1-0 heading into the singles matches, the Presidents fell yet again in all six matches.
Abhinav Yarramaneni (Mountain View, Calif./Los Altos) played one of W&J's most competitive matches at No. 3 singles, falling 7-5 in the first set and 6-1 in the final set.
Aarav Surapaneni (Coraopolis, Pa./Moon Area) also took the final game to 7-5 of his match at No. 6 singles with some late fight. Surapaneni ultimately fell 6-0, 7-5.
